### Restore
#### Restore the VolumeSnapshotContent from the backup instead of creating a new one dynamically
#### Restore the VolumeSnapshotContent
The current behavior of VSC restoration is that the VSC from the backup is restore, and the restored VS also triggers creating a new VSC dynamically.
Two VSCs created for the same VS in one restore seems not right.
@ -106,6 +106,16 @@ If the `SkipRestore` is set true in the restore action's result, the secret retu
As a result, restore the VSC from the backup, and setup the VSC and the VS's relation is a better choice.
Another consideration is the VSC name should not be the same as the backed-up VSC's, because the older version Velero's restore and backup keep the VSC after completion.
There's high possibility that the restore will fail due to the VSC already exists in the cluster.
Multiple restores of the same backup will also meet the same problem.
The proposed solution is using the restore's UID and the VS's name to generate sha256 hash value as the new VSC name. Both the VS and VSC RestoreItemAction can access those UIDs, and it will avoid the conflicts issues.
The restored VS name also shares the same generated name.
The VS-referenced VSC name and the VSC's snapshot handle name are in their status.
Velero restore process purges the restore resources' metadata and status before running the RestoreItemActions.
@ -114,6 +124,78 @@ As a result, we cannot read these information in the VS and VSC RestoreItemActio
Fortunately, RestoreItemAction input parameters includes the `ItemFromBackup`. The status is intact in `ItemFromBackup`.

Because VSC is not restored dynamically, if we run restores two times for the same backup in the same cluster, the second restore will fail due to the VSC is there in the cluster, and it is already bound to an existing VS.
To avoid this issue, it's better to delete the restored VS and VSC after restore completes.
The VolumeSnapshot and VolumeSnapshotContent are delete in the `restore_finalizer_controller`.

### Backup Sync
csi-volumesnapshotclasses.json, csi-volumesnapshotcontents.json, and csi-volumesnapshots.json are CSI-related metadata files in the BSL for each backup.
@ -266,8 +296,17 @@ For the VSC DeleteItemAction, we need to generate a VSC. Because we only care ab
Create a static VSC, then point it to a pseudo VS, and reference to the snapshot handle should be enough.
To avoid the created VSC conflict with older version Velero B/R generated ones, the VSC name is set to `vsc-uuid`.
The following is an example of the implementation.

@ -109,8 +109,8 @@ Velero will include the generated VolumeSnapshot and VolumeSnapshotContent objec
upload all VolumeSnapshots and VolumeSnapshotContents objects in a JSON file to the object storage system. **Note that
only Kubernetes objects are uploaded to the object storage, not the data in snapshots.**
When Velero synchronizes backups into a new cluster, VolumeSnapshotContent objects and the VolumeSnapshotClass that is chosen to take
snapshot will be synced into the cluster as well, so that Velero can manage backup expiration appropriately.
From v1.16, when Velero synchronizes backups into a new cluster, the VolumeSnapshotClass that is chosen to take
snapshot will be synced into the cluster, so that Velero can manage backup expiration appropriately.
The `DeletionPolicy` on the VolumeSnapshotContent will be the same as the `DeletionPolicy` on the VolumeSnapshotClass that was used to create the VolumeSnapshot. Setting a `DeletionPolicy` of `Retain` on the VolumeSnapshotClass will preserve the volume snapshot in the storage system for the lifetime of the Velero backup and will prevent the deletion of the volume snapshot, in the storage system, in the event of a disaster where the namespace with the VolumeSnapshot object may be lost.
